Define Your Viewing Goals

The most crucial starting point is to clarify what you want to watch. Ask yourself whether you are looking for new series for everyday viewing, major film releases for weekends, or specific genres like horror, fantasy, anime, or crime. Without this clarity, even the best streaming calendar can become cluttered.

Consider organizing your viewing interests into three lists:

  1. Must-Watch Titles: Shows or films you definitely want to see.
  2. Maybe List: Interesting new series that you’re unsure about.
  3. Watch Later: Good options for quieter weeks.

This simple classification can save you significant time and streamline your search process. If you subscribe to multiple services, consider categorizing by purpose: short evening series, weekend films, family-friendly programs, and titles suitable for group viewing.

Collecting Release Dates from Reliable Sources

Now it’s time to gather accurate release dates. Many users make the mistake of relying solely on app homepages, which often highlight only selected titles. Instead, utilize multiple sources for comprehensive information.

Follow this straightforward sequence:

  1. Check the Provider Directly: Look at sections labeled ‘New’, ‘Coming Soon’, or ‘Recently Added’ for the quickest updates on release dates and highlights.
  2. Consult Editorial Overviews: These calendars can help prioritize titles based on relevance, allowing you to spot potential conversation starters.
  3. Watch Trailers and Check Press Releases: Trailers can quickly indicate whether a title is a must-see or a skip, saving time in your decision-making process.

Always document date, provider, format, and type of release. Understanding whether a series is released weekly or all at once significantly impacts your viewing strategy.

Organizing Your Streaming Calendar

Once you have collected several release dates, organization becomes crucial. Enter each title into a list with stable columns. For beginners, five key details suffice:

  • Date
  • Title
  • Provider
  • Film or Series
  • Priority

Enhance your calendar with two additional columns for:

  • Release Mode: complete or weekly
  • Decision Aid: watch, monitor, or skip

This method creates clarity, transforming multiple open tabs and apps into a structured overview of what’s relevant this week versus what can wait.

Evaluating Trailers, Runtime, and Release Models

As you narrow down your choices, it’s essential to evaluate each title thoroughly. Many viewers jump in blindly, which can lead to disappointment. Instead, conduct a quick check in the following order:

  1. Watch the Trailer: It gives insight into the pace, tone, cast, and target audience, helping you decide if it suits your evening.
  2. Check the Runtime: A lengthy film may not be ideal if you have limited time. The same applies to series; knowing how many episodes and their lengths is vital for planning.
  3. Note the Release Model: Is it a complete series drop or weekly episodes? This distinction affects your viewing schedule and social discussions.

Making Quick Decisions with a Simple Method

Often, viewers waste time not on searching but on deciding. To streamline this, implement a quick three-question assessment for each new title:

  • Does the title match your mood?
  • Do you have enough time to watch it?
  • Is it relevant to your current social conversations?

This method is particularly effective for new series. If two out of three criteria are not met, move the title to your Watch Later list, allowing for a more organized approach.
